Using Google Earth to Teach the Magnitude of Deep Time

by: Joel D. Parker

Most timeline analogies of geologic and evolutionary time are flawed, causing an understanding of relative time with little comprehension of absolute time. Using Google Earth, one can construct an ideal timeline analogy relative to a point in the classroom with locally adaptable markers for important events in geologic time.
